Transaction 14bbf496a06183581275892906adb75f92dc9edd60a5ecc8e22fda337a799ddf
1 Input
1 Output
-
14bbf496a06183581275892906adb75f92dc9edd60a5ecc8e22fda337a799ddf:0
- value
- 17772434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d0a6ed2b0c171cdfea197f7dd7a9ce7486a0e15 OP_EQUAL
- address
- MR8iSaQxM5wqvVkPPHESwdRJtAWSYcc1Kk